How Much Do Removals Companies Charge in Berkshire?

What’s the typical price range for removals in Berkshire?

Most Berkshire removals companies charge between £1,500 and £5,000 for a standard house move. The exact price depends on distance, house size, and complexity. A small flat move might cost £800 to £1,500. A large family home could reach £4,000 to £6,000 or more.

Companies typically quote based on the volume of items and transport distance. A removal from Reading to Wokingham (about 20 miles) costs less than moving to London. Always get multiple quotes to compare prices fairly. Most reputable firms offer free quotes and site surveys before committing.

What Factors Affect Your Removals Quote?

Why do prices vary so much between different removal companies?

Several things influence your final bill. House size matters most: a three-bedroom semi needs more resources than a one-bedroom flat. Distance travelled affects fuel and labour costs significantly. Moving time also plays a role; weekend and bank holiday moves typically cost 10-20% more.

Packing services, storage, and specialist handling (pianos, artwork) add extra charges. Some companies include basic insurance, whilst others charge separately. Peak moving season (May to September) sees higher rates than winter moves. Always ask what’s included in your quote to avoid unexpected costs later.

Should You Get Multiple Quotes?

Is it worth getting quotes from several removal companies?

Yes, absolutely. Prices between Berkshire removal companies can vary by 30-50% for identical moves. Getting three to five quotes takes just a few hours and saves hundreds of pounds. Most companies offer free no-obligation quotes. You’ll spot fair pricing and spotty ones quickly.

When comparing quotes, look beyond the basic price. Check insurance cover, what’s included, and customer reviews. A cheaper quote isn’t always better if the company has poor reviews or missing services. Professional companies usually provide itemised quotes showing labour hours, van sizes, and additional charges clearly.

How Can You Reduce Your Removals Costs?

What’s the easiest way to cut your removals bill?

Declutter ruthlessly before moving day. Removing unwanted items reduces the number of boxes and van space needed. You’ll pay less overall for transport and labour. Consider selling, donating, or recycling things you no longer need.

Flexible moving dates also help lower costs. Mid-week moves (Tuesday to Thursday) are typically 15-25% cheaper than Saturdays. Moving during quieter months like November to February brings better rates. Ask about off-peak discounts when getting quotes. You can handle your own packing to save labour costs, though professional packing costs usually aren’t excessive. Pre-packing some non-fragile items yourself is a smart compromise.

FAQ

Q: Do I need to pay a deposit when booking a removal company?
A: Most reputable Berkshire removal companies ask for a deposit (usually 10-25% of the total cost) to secure your booking date. This protects both you and the company.

Q: Are removal company quotes in Berkshire usually accurate?
A: Quotes are estimates based on the information you provide. If your move is more complex than described, final costs might vary slightly. Always discuss potential extra charges before moving day.

Q: What’s included in a standard removal quote?
A: Standard quotes typically include labour, vehicle hire, and basic transport. Additional items like packing materials, insurance, and storage cost extra and must be requested separately.

Q: Can I negotiate removal prices in Berkshire?
A: Possibly, especially if you’re flexible with dates or moving during quiet periods. It doesn’t hurt to ask, but professional companies have set pricing structures for fair reasons.

Q: Should I tip my removal team in Berkshire?
A: Tipping isn’t mandatory, but it’s appreciated for good work. Many people give £20 to £50 depending on team size and service quality.
